class FunctionalTestSuite
Discovers tests for the functional test suite.
Hierarchy
- class \Drupal\Tests\TestSuites\TestSuiteBase extends \PHPUnit\Framework\TestSuite- class \Drupal\Tests\TestSuites\FunctionalTestSuite extends \Drupal\Tests\TestSuites\TestSuiteBase
 
Expanded class hierarchy of FunctionalTestSuite
Deprecated
in drupal:10.3.0 and is removed from drupal:11.0.0. There is no replacement and test discovery will be handled differently in PHPUnit 10.
See also
https://www.drupal.org/node/3405829
File
- 
              core/tests/ TestSuites/ FunctionalTestSuite.php, line 17 
Namespace
Drupal\Tests\TestSuitesView source
class FunctionalTestSuite extends TestSuiteBase {
  
  /**
   * Factory method which loads up a suite with all functional tests.
   *
   * @return static
   *   The test suite.
   */
  public static function suite() {
    $root = dirname(__DIR__, 3);
    $suite = new static('functional');
    $suite->addTestsBySuiteNamespace($root, 'Functional');
    return $suite;
  }
}Members
| Title Sort descending | Modifiers | Object type | Summary | Overrides | 
|---|---|---|---|---|
| FunctionalTestSuite::suite | public static | function | Factory method which loads up a suite with all functional tests. | |
| TestSuiteBase::addTestsBySuiteNamespace | protected | function | Find and add tests to the suite for core and any extensions. | |
| TestSuiteBase::findExtensionDirectories | protected | function | Finds extensions in a Drupal installation. | 1 | 
Buggy or inaccurate documentation? Please file an issue. Need support? Need help programming? Connect with the Drupal community.
